The cheapest way to get from Ferbane to Galway is to drive which costs €15 - €23 and takes 1h 8m.
The fastest way to get from Ferbane to Galway is to drive which takes 1h 8m and costs €15 - €23.
No, there is no direct bus from Ferbane to Galway. However, there are services departing from Ferbane and arriving at Merchants Rd via Birr.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 10m.
The distance between Ferbane and Galway is 100 km. The road distance is 90.3 km.
The best way to get from Ferbane to Galway without a car is to line 72 bus and train which takes 2h 28m and costs €18 - €27.
It takes approximately 2h 28m to get from Ferbane to Galway, including transfers.
Ferbane to Galway bus services, operated by Kearns Transport, depart from Birr station.
Ferbane to Galway bus services, operated by Kearns Transport, arrive at Merchants Rd station.
Yes, the driving distance between Ferbane to Galway is 90 km. It takes approximately 1h 8m to drive from Ferbane to Galway.
